Replacing the keyboard

To replace the keyboard:
1. Remove any media (diskettes, CDs, or memory cards) from the drives,
shut down your operating system, and turn off all attached devices and the
computer.
2. Unplug all power cords from electrical outlets.
3. Locate the connector for the keyboard. Refer to "Locating connectors on the
rear of the computer" and "Locating connectors on the front of the computer".
Note: Your keyboard might be connected to the standard keyboard
connector
the front or rear of the computer.
4. Disconnect the failing keyboard cable from the computer and connect the new
keyboard cable to the same connector.
5. Refer to the "Completing the installation".
